To
further its commitment to promoting world peace, The Sasakawa
Peace Foundation (SPF) in Tokyo launched the "Culture
and Identity-Ethnic Coexistence in Asia" (Culture and Identity)
Program in 1994. SPF sought to draw upon successful experiences
in Asia's rich tradition of ethnic coexistence in order to contribute
to the prevention and resolution of ethnic conflicts around the
world.
The
Culture and Identity Program looked at the relationship between concepts
such as pluralism, equality and other ethnicity-related
values in indigenous Asian communities, mainly through the eyes of
Asian researchers. Research focused on four themes when analyzing
how Asian communities accommodate ethnicity issues: media, multicultural-ism,
the collective rights of ethnic groups, and education. For three
years,
the Program sought to 1) probe the mechanisms and cultural dynamics
of ethnic coexistence in Asia and 2) identify the common elements
found in examples of harmonious ethnic relations. Ultimately, the
Program
extracted and redefined the successful experiences of ethnic coexistence
into "Asian models of harmonious coexistence." After its initial three years of research based in Tokyo,
the Program was relocated to SPF-USA (Washington, DC) in September
1997. During the next two years, the Program disseminated its findings
to Asian and non-Asian audiences under the direction of then Program
Manager, Ms. Kayoko Tatsumi.
The Culture and Identity Program produced four publications
that identified the cross-cultural themes of Asian ethnic coexistence.
To access these publications, please visit the SPF-USA
Library:
Sasakawa Peace Foundation USA (ed), Multiculturalism: Modes of
Coexistence in South and Southeast Asia, Washington, DC: SPF-USA,
1999.
Goonasekera, Anura and Ito, Youichi (eds), Mass Media and Cultural
Identity: Ethnic Reporting in Asia, Sterling: Pluto Press,
1999.
Rupesinghe, Kumar (ed), Culture and Identity: Ethnic Coexistence in
the Asian Context, Washington, DC: SPF-USA, 1999.
Recommendations for Policy and Further Study, a booklet from the SPF-USA
Program: Culture and Identity: Ethnic Coexistence in Asia, Washington, DC:
SPF-USA,
1999.
